How they compare
El Salvador currently reports 62,781 against 61,215 in Jordan, a difference of 1,566.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 26 shared years of data; in 1990 it was El Salvador ahead.
El Salvador ranks 97th and Jordan ranks 99th of 191 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, El Salvador averaged higher in 2 and Jordan in 1.
